pub enum UpvalueTarget {
Local(LocalIndex),
Upvalue(UpvalueIndex),
}
Variants§
Local(LocalIndex)
Upvalue(UpvalueIndex)
Trait Implementations§
Source§impl Clone for UpvalueTarget
impl Clone for UpvalueTarget
Source§fn clone(&self) -> UpvalueTarget
fn clone(&self) -> UpvalueTarget
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for UpvalueTarget
impl Debug for UpvalueTarget
impl Copy for UpvalueTarget
Auto Trait Implementations§
impl Freeze for UpvalueTarget
impl RefUnwindSafe for UpvalueTarget
impl Send for UpvalueTarget
impl Sync for UpvalueTarget
impl Unpin for UpvalueTarget
impl UnwindSafe for UpvalueTarget
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more